Sister Regina Kehoe, OSU

NEW ROCHELLE, N.Y. — Sister Regina Kehoe, a member of the Ursulines for the Roman Union Eastern Province USA for 73 years, died Feb. 24 at the United Hebrew Home in New Rochelle, N.Y. She was 95.

Sister Regina spent 60 years in education, including in the Diocese of Wilmington at Ursuline Academy’s lower school. She said in a Facebook video from 2017 that it was her southernmost assignment. She also served at other Ursuline schools, mostly in New York. She taught gerontology at the College of New Rochelle, and she also served on the board of trustees at several schools.

In addition, Sister Regina was provincial of the Eastern Province of the congregation from 1973-79, leading a group that numbered approximately 300 women religious. She was a member of the Office of Evangelization in the Archdiocese of New York from 1979-82 and was assistant coordinator of Pope John Paul II’s visit to New York in 1979.
